Audric Ackermann
d948045e6a
added hf switching of poll&store requests + tests
4 years ago
Audric Ackermann
363977b358
add polling from namespace 0 and storing lastHash with namespace
4 years ago
Audric Ackermann
50ca1bcda9
added namespace field and signature using it for our own 'retrieve'
4 years ago
Audric Ackermann
b93201fbe6
When deleting multiple messages, inform the user of the number
...
taken from #2263 by @ianmacd
4 years ago
Audric Ackermann
bfb33d14c5
Merge pull request #2269 from Bilb/get-initials-skip-non-alphabet-chars
...
Get initials skip non alphabet chars
4 years ago
Audric Ackermann
71aa6e8bb4
lint and add test for getInitials and name with '-' as separator
4 years ago
Audric Ackermann
5c9c7173f0
Merge remote-tracking branch 'i/pr9' into get-initials-skip-non-alphabet-chars
4 years ago
Audric Ackermann
a115d385dd
merge linkify component to messagebody as this is the only one using it
4 years ago
Audric Ackermann
cae4d46492
allow to save attachments even if there is multiple of them
...
This is a bit dirty for now
Relates #2229
4 years ago
Audric Ackermann
1933bc8270
Merge pull request #2264 from ianmacd/pr19
...
Style message request counter as per conversation message count.
4 years ago
Audric Ackermann
da9df532b0
Merge pull request #2242 from Bilb/node-side-in-ts
...
Node side + web worker in typescript
4 years ago
Audric Ackermann
8b299b6153
Merge koray fixes for emoji selection
4 years ago
Audric Ackermann
851d5280e0
fixup build appImage sqlite3 module not found
4 years ago
Audric Ackermann
0efce6ea2d
updating workflows actions version
4 years ago
Ian Macdonald
8107d75e89
Style message request counter as per conversation message count.
4 years ago
Audric Ackermann
4010373a7b
make sure we do not save more than one entry in the read_by
...
Session has read by only for private chats, so we do not care about
having more than one entry in read_by
4 years ago
Audric Ackermann
368c0cd01b
drop sourceDevice and other unused json fields from msg table
4 years ago
Audric Ackermann
5c8e2b4044
cleanup swarm unused after removing unused convos
4 years ago
Audric Ackermann
2207b53890
add a test to make sure the targets in package.json are well formatted
4 years ago
Audric Ackermann
b8498f7a2b
fix display of spinner while db decrypting
4 years ago
Audric Ackermann
1e713de511
Merge remote-tracking branch 'k/spinner-on-load' into node-side-in-ts
4 years ago
Audric Ackermann
dbcae0f844
fix logs privacy test
4 years ago
Audric Ackermann
7c1707f48e
drop old messages of opengroup
4 years ago
Audric Ackermann
c8e7be066e
remove messages from opengroup > 2k messages and older than 6 months
4 years ago
Audric Ackermann
335e452730
moved DebugLogView to components folder
4 years ago
Audric Ackermann
f4bf960568
Merge pull request #2243 from warrickct/show-group-members-freeze-fix
...
fix group members sorting causing error.
4 years ago
Audric Ackermann
3cfcf128a5
Merge remote-tracking branch 'upstream/master' into node-side-in-ts
4 years ago
Audric Ackermann
13e2f81f26
Merge remote-tracking branch 'upstream/clearnet' into node-side-in-ts
4 years ago
Audric Ackermann
4baedda349
add tests for opengroup utils
4 years ago
Audric Ackermann
1b2564abf5
fix ci builds
4 years ago
Audric Ackermann
5c9b34fb86
lint files
4 years ago
Audric Ackermann
add267ae69
make the util worker be bundled with parcel
4 years ago
Audric Ackermann
e5c54cc45e
added some test for DecryptingAttachmentManager
4 years ago
Audric Ackermann
b76797d264
do not use a custom sandbox for testing
...
instead use the one from Sinon as it is exposed for a good reason
4 years ago
Audric Ackermann
e11775a2e0
fix color of opengroup invitation
4 years ago
koray-eren
d7361f0774
fix linter issue
4 years ago
koray-eren
c872f22014
password screen spinner implemented
4 years ago
Audric Ackermann
6001da5ac8
add some [perf] duration measurement
4 years ago
Audric Ackermann
af9d2fdfa1
get rid of libtextsecure.js and componnets.js
4 years ago
Audric Ackermann
323b7ec45c
cleanup >2 months old messages in opengroups
4 years ago
Audric Ackermann
c6d66ea111
add image smoothing medium when auto scaling images
4 years ago
Audric Ackermann
01bb200b24
reduce number of commits during opengroup handling of message
4 years ago
Audric Ackermann
062db5caab
move filterDuplicatesFromDbAndIncoming to its own file and test
...
also add pending tests to do for in memory db and updater
4 years ago
Audric Ackermann
0158fd5ebb
filter duplicates on opengroup poll in a single sql call
4 years ago
Audric Ackermann
00d70db0be
queue user profile avatars update
...
also add some tests for the promise utils
4 years ago
Ian Macdonald
d14486b462
Make configuration sync every 2 days, in line with the comment.
4 years ago
Audric Ackermann
a9cc9a7294
add tests for attachment metadata
4 years ago
Audric Ackermann
02612280c3
fix multi select including audio messages
4 years ago
Audric Ackermann
afd63c230e
remove unused curve compiled files
4 years ago
Audric Ackermann
475c92eeb4
migrate about_start to not use jquery
4 years ago
Audric Ackermann
f164302617
remove files which shouldn't be here
4 years ago
Audric Ackermann
261940e978
fix tests
4 years ago
Audric Ackermann
5047e8921b
made all verifi signatures in a single call to the worker
4 years ago
Audric Ackermann
940972db2f
fix libsodium call from webworker
4 years ago
Audric Ackermann
b4dc18d65b
migrate app focus logic to events sent from node
4 years ago
Audric Ackermann
1ebff6b3ae
make sure reply is available to read messages
...
and do not handle read messages for non private convo1
4 years ago
Audric Ackermann
0ebc1d7e92
split attachmnent logic between what is used on main and renderer
4 years ago
Audric Ackermann
332d58027f
show draggable call container when opening settings from call convo
4 years ago
koray-eren
d78056618c
fix linter issue
4 years ago
koray-eren
ebe1ae8f12
fix emoticon search for emoji picker, typo
4 years ago
koray-eren
b4a57b32eb
changed emoji trigger to exclude non-alphanumeric characters
4 years ago
warrickct
3eb6bec908
fix group members sorting causing error.
4 years ago
Audric Ackermann
9f8920ef2c
mostly working but need to improve perfs
4 years ago
Audric Ackermann
4d72b92b25
app starts but full of errors
4 years ago
Audric Ackermann
909bca8714
Merge branch 'clearnet' into enable-calls-remove-featureflag
4 years ago
Audric Ackermann
fe57531797
Sesion 1.8.4 with calls enabled
4 years ago
Audric Ackermann
2b17ad5cfa
WIP
4 years ago
Audric Ackermann
280cc494e8
test with webpack - not working
4 years ago
Audric Ackermann
2dfd09a7b1
app kind of start background side
4 years ago
Ian Macdonald
59d45b69a9
Skip characters that are not in any alphabet or number system.
4 years ago
Audric Ackermann
6e8e8eaa9a
move errors.js to ts
4 years ago
Audric Ackermann
79bf0c53ee
move libtextsecure/crypto.js to ts
...
used mostly for attachments encrypting before upload/decrypt and profile
encrypt/derypt
4 years ago
Audric Ackermann
5bc576249b
move signal.js to TS
4 years ago
Audric Ackermann
ff43cfa593
move worker_interface and logs and i18n to TS
4 years ago
Audric Ackermann
0dfa3e35cc
refactor main_node.js to TS
4 years ago
Audric Ackermann
afad9f823a
Merge pull request #2237 from Bilb/fix-add-attachments-ourself
...
make sure the conversation with ourself is marked approvedMe
4 years ago
Audric Ackermann
0719700371
do not end call if connection fails, instead wait for new offer
4 years ago
Audric Ackermann
70ee8cefdc
WIP sql.js
4 years ago
Audric Ackermann
9f3379e702
moved global_errors.js to ts
4 years ago
Audric Ackermann
f433acda77
move config.js to typescript
4 years ago
Audric Ackermann
175c0e4843
move logging.js to ts
4 years ago
Audric Ackermann
d37d7af667
moved permissions.js to ts
4 years ago
Audric Ackermann
b36be1cbbb
move main.js to main_node.ts, still plenty of errors
4 years ago
Audric Ackermann
5b1379f930
move protocol_filter to typescript
4 years ago
Audric Ackermann
38774a9344
moved a bunch of node files to typescript
4 years ago
Audric Ackermann
12d9a8db78
electron-renderer webpack seems to be generating main_renderer.js
4 years ago
Audric Ackermann
bfaeda5cdb
make sure the conversation with ourself is marked approvedMe
4 years ago
Audric Ackermann
0cb4a13494
add tests for timerBucket icon
...
this marks unit test number 302, previous: 237
4 years ago
Audric Ackermann
fd1657037a
add tests for emoji size rendering in messages
4 years ago
Audric Ackermann
ba53330afd
add tests for getInitials
4 years ago
Audric Ackermann
2a11d5e71f
trigger a new offer on connect fail if we are caller
...
the caller is just supposed to accept the offer and send an answer back
4 years ago
Audric Ackermann
51575d2f56
moved views to TS but broken
4 years ago
Audric Ackermann
449751a891
remove some refs to Signal.Data in ts
4 years ago
Audric Ackermann
d99cdc48f4
rename background.js to main_start.js
4 years ago
Audric Ackermann
15260c9718
move logging.js to ts
4 years ago
Audric Ackermann
7d570fec52
move linkPreviews.js to ts
4 years ago
Audric Ackermann
0e2cf98d96
move privacy.js to ts
4 years ago
Audric Ackermann
6bd835dfc3
move storage.js to ts
4 years ago
Audric Ackermann
747bcb766c
move notifications.js to ts
4 years ago
Audric Ackermann
6334f7cb45
move registration.js to ts
4 years ago
Audric Ackermann
0d4059ccb1
move read_receipts to ts
4 years ago
Audric Ackermann
0b814d4d16
remove read sync as we do not care about them on Session
4 years ago
Audric Ackermann
1ff836865a
after moving focusListener to ts
4 years ago
Audric Ackermann
e78224db05
after moving expiring message and wallclock to TS
4 years ago
Audric Ackermann
d7f84168ac
before start of moving bg JS to TS
4 years ago
Audric Ackermann
ce0848c8bf
Merge branch 'clearnet' into updater-reword
4 years ago
Audric Ackermann
9d4989b66d
cleanup constants.tsx file
...
and fixup commit id showing at the bottom in settings
4 years ago
Audric Ackermann
89757a95a6
use readyForUpdates to trigger update from renderer
...
this is used to only start the updater once the fileserver returned use
the latest release
4 years ago
Audric Ackermann
2f02d3e21c
use source instead of senderIdentity to check for approved new group
4 years ago
Audric Ackermann
d2fc384d16
fix text selection on text
4 years ago
Audric Ackermann
67e2fea70c
Merge pull request #2207 from ianmacd/pr8
...
Allow user names up to 26 characters long, in line with Android.
4 years ago
Audric Ackermann
74cf88cf81
create closed group mark as approved
...
also, do not filter closed group based on the isApproved field in redux
4 years ago
Ian Macdonald
a11b078d5b
Allow user names up to 26 characters long, in line with Android.
...
See https://github.com/oxen-io/session-android/blob/master/libsession/src/main/java/org/session/libsession/utilities/SSKEnvironment.kt#L29
4 years ago
Audric Ackermann
234e9b160e
Make sure updater do not hit github before checking fileserver
4 years ago
Audric Ackermann
49bae1925d
open message request reset opened convo and is a settings itself
4 years ago
Audric Ackermann
878c870a8b
initials are always uppercased
4 years ago
Audric Ackermann
2cf2d9eff7
make sure datebreak keep text color
4 years ago
Audric Ackermann
461ce4a7fb
Merge branch 'clearnet' into fix-unread-indicator-light
4 years ago
Audric Ackermann
551fc4e2d7
make the unread message banner on a single line
4 years ago
Audric Ackermann
ad653e4aac
change sent background and text color for light mode
...
use black text on green instead of white on darker green
4 years ago
Audric Ackermann
43d133519e
do not shrink member list items when list is full
4 years ago
Audric Ackermann
602a287263
join closed groups from config only on the first config message
4 years ago
Audric Ackermann
e853f57e6b
fix unread indicator color for light theme
4 years ago
Audric Ackermann
71aa6c813c
Merge remote-tracking branch 'upstream/clearnet' into fix-i18n-with-dollars-sign
4 years ago
Audric Ackermann
359dcaa43a
Merge pull request #2174 from warrickct/msg-request-ui-2
...
Message request
4 years ago
Audric Ackermann
75c7c7c27f
try a fix to prevent window from jumping with low number of messages
4 years ago
warrickct
3424fa88e8
Remove typing for blocklist on window. Minor formatting
4 years ago
warrickct
b166a0483a
Adding logging output for dropping outdated config messages. Removing libsodium-wrapper usage as we use sumo version now. Making target for linux build on one line.
4 years ago
warrickct
b79be5b502
adding linting fixes.
4 years ago
warrickct
5adca482bd
Fix open groups not being restored when restoring device from recovery phrase.
4 years ago
warrickct
4ee51b4ee9
Removing open group blocklist code.
4 years ago
Audric Ackermann
8a13a9e6e0
Merge pull request #2183 from ianmacd/pr5
...
Use up to two scaled placeholder characters for users with no avatar.
4 years ago
Audric Ackermann
e1f2393c3a
cleanup translated strings
4 years ago
warrickct
614cdccd2c
Switch to window logging.
4 years ago
warrickct
f3cefdcf49
Add logging for debugging.
4 years ago
warrickct
096e1d24df
Fix linting error, remove unnecessary conditional
4 years ago
warrickct
380d55066a
Reducing excessive calls to open group blocklist.
4 years ago
Ian Macdonald
fa0c1fff88
Use up to two scaled initials as a placeholder for users with no avatar.
...
If the user's name consists of just a single word, then use up to two
letters from that word as the placeholder.
This provides better differentiation of users than the current practice
of using just a single letter for everyone.
4 years ago
warrickct
75191ae757
Add blocking joining open group based on blocklist.
4 years ago
warrickct
821f4d73ff
Merge branch 'clearnet' into msg-request-ui-2
4 years ago
Audric Ackermann
f1900f9f36
remove some unused strings
...
and fix tos links #2176
4 years ago
warrickct
913947a517
Minor padding fixes
4 years ago
warrickct
0f7bf5d2d1
Remove unnecessary conditional
4 years ago
warrickct
3c2cc9be8a
Only check for incoming messages on initial render of request UI.
4 years ago
warrickct
322c9756ca
switch to lodash pick
4 years ago
warrickct
68eceae153
fixed flex behaviour for call and avatar convo header buttons.
4 years ago
warrickct
cf6a5b3446
Request banner appearing and tallying based on only unread requests
4 years ago
warrickct
451fb351a3
removing comments
4 years ago
warrickct
f7a4e7ee81
Move disappearing message indicator to right of conversation header.
4 years ago
warrickct
e4f4328232
rename request evaluating function for clarity. Prevent disappearing messsages from being activated by request recipient before the request has been accepted.
4 years ago